At its core, reduced voltage electrical wiring refers to electric systems that operate at 50 volts or much less. This makes them safer to deal with compared to basic electrical systems, which normally operate at 120V or higher. The decreased voltage not only minimizes the danger of electrical shock but additionally enables using thinner wires, which can streamline installment and minimize products expenses. Typical applications consist of lighting control systems, thermostats, and alarm, every one of which can work efficiently on low voltage circuitry.

Nonetheless, it is very important to follow finest techniques when dealing with low voltage electrical wiring. Appropriate installment involves recognizing the appropriate scale of cord to utilize, which is established by the distance in between your source of power and the device being powered. Utilizing a wire that is as well slim for the application can bring about voltage decline, which may cause insufficient efficiency of the linked device. Furthermore, making certain to make use of high-quality ports and regularly following regional building codes will guarantee both safety and efficiency in your installation.
